Sean 'Diddy' Combs told ex-assistant that 'young' Cassie Ventura was 'moldable'
Share and Follow

Diddy’s former assistant, Rashida Salaam, testified that Diddy told her he saw Cassie as someone he could mold into what he wanted. Salaam also stated that Diddy sounded “excited” about Cassie and called her “young and impressionable.”

David James, who had worked for the Bad Boy Records founder from 2007 to 2009, testified he was with Combs in Miami when he first met the “Me & U” singer nearly two decades ago.

Speaking at a hearing at the US District Court for the Southern District of New York, in Lower Manhattan in the rapper’s high-profile federal sex trafficking trial, James recalled how Combs would describe Ventura.

“‘I’ve got [Ventura] right where I want her, she’s young,’” Combs allegedly told him.

“He said she was very moldable,” James recalled.

Elsewhere, James testified that he was in the car with Combs and an associate when the rapper began talking about girlfriend Kim Porter, the mother of four of his seven children.

James, who is the third prosecution witness to testify during the second week of the trial, told jurors that the “I’ll Be Missing You” rapper had a roster of women he was dating at the time.

“Ms. Porter was his main girlfriend,” he said in court, adding that Combs had dated at least three other women at the time, including “Sarah,” “Tara” and “Cassie.”

Porter died of pneumonia in 2018. She was 47.

James also recalled another incident in 2007, when he smoked cigarettes with Ventura and her pal Kerry Morgan during a trip to Combs’ exclusive Star Island.

“Man, this lifestyle is crazy?” Ventura said to him, he told jurors.

He then asked her “why” she didn’t leave the rapper, to which she responded, “I can’t get out. Mr. Combs oversees so much of my life.”

In addition to having total control of her music career, Combs oversaw Ventura’s finances, James said in court.

“He paid for her apartment,” he testified, adding that the “Finna Get Loose” rapper also gave her an allowance.

The trial wrapped just after 3 p.m. Monday and James is expected to continue testifying Tuesday morning.

Combs, 55, faces a minimum of 15 years in prison after being charged with sex trafficking, racketeering and fraud. He had been locked up without bail while awaiting trial.
